The Design has the Holy ShrineS of Imam Husain (right) & His Brother Hazrat Abbas (the Left) in Karbala with the Holy Names of Allah, Prophet Muhammad PBUH & Imam Ali AS the Panjtan between. Below these in the Frame is Salams or Salutions to Imam Husain, His Son & Imam Ali Al-Sajjad, His Sons & Daughters & His Companions Martyred in Karbala. On the sides of the Frame in written the Holy Names of Fatimah Alzahra & Her Sons of Imams to Imam Mahdi AS.
On the lower part is the Zulfikar Sword that on its blade is written the Dua of NADE ALI.
On 4 corners inside Circles are written the Holy Names of 4 ArchAngels: Gabriel ( Jebril ), Michael ( Mikaeel ), Israfil & Israeel.
After all these you can see inside the frame surrounding is the Ayat Al-Kursy that muslims recite to keep them safe.
Shia Muslims have to use MOHR or Turbah in their Prayers called SALAT or NAMAZ. They place their Turbah inside such Clothes to protect being damaged. They also place the Turbah on these clothes to keep it clean & also as they pray & say words when their headfront on the Turbah no dust enter their mouth & get ill.
The most beloved Mohrs are those coming from Karbala in Iraq & then those from Mashhad & Qum in Iran.
